Benefits of using machinery in industries and factories
Machinery refers to the machines, tools, and systems man has developed for aid in the
working environment. “The different working environment has specific tools meant for their
exclusive use or application”. Industries and factories refer to the organization and places where
the production of various things happens. Use of machinery is dated to have first seen the light in
the 16th century. Perhaps the first machinery set to be put up was the one used in drawing water
from the well Laursen and Keld.( 2015, 99-115). Later the demand in the textile industry could
not resist mechanization.
The above two aspects belong to the same environment hence the worth to discuss.
“Machinery has been applied and used in factories and industries to ease work and improve the
speed at work for decades”. The improvement in speed has increased the profit margin the
producers or the manufacturers make in a given trade period. The quality has also been
significantly improved, leading to jobs creation. The advantages of using machinery in factories
are numerous, and this give adequate reasons to discuss this topic Fu, Hsin-Pin, and Tsung-
Sheng Chang, (2016, 1741-1756).
The machines were initially manual, later; the electrically driven ones came into play of
the industrial use. Today, the use of machinery has moved to the next level owing form the
internet of things and the revolution of artificial intelligence. For instance, in farming, planting,

Narrowing to the mechanization of wheat or potatoes harvest, it is evident that the ability
and human capacity in this work cannot outdo the mechanical counterpart. “The use of
machinery is faster and can cover vast terrain of land within a short period” Cingano, Federico,
and Paolo Pinotti, (2016, 1-13). This saves the expenses on human power and reduces the risk of
the perishability of the product before the harvesting is complete. The advantage of this aspect is
that we can have few individuals involved in the farming of a product of interest but can meet the
demand of the product.
“Machines in industries functions based on the settings the human operator apply”.
Consequently, the end product is similar in quality and quantity package. Considering a dozen of
water glasses, it is challenging to identify the glass you spotted first after a slight change of the
pattern Turner, Christopher , et al, (2017, 882-894). The case is as a result of the high level of
accuracy in machinery based production for items meant to be similar. The argument above will
take a different course if the item in consideration is a molded clay pot.
